Austria vs Greece: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) (modeled ILO estimate)

Side-by-side comparison from World Bank Open Data.

In , Austria's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) (modeled ILO estimate) was 65.42, compared to Greece's 59.86. That makes Austria's value 9.3% higher than Greece's.
